Output de1bc957c1022af1507a52054451f693287b925038a6ed2d57d3dcf8fa8cae0c:0

value
8967442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d913c56cc2c11e552960e310812973e1a34b7f41 OP_EQUAL
address
3MUpEu12L8zcUeJQTyN8dtfYX9iXVZu2f1
transaction
de1bc957c1022af1507a52054451f693287b925038a6ed2d57d3dcf8fa8cae0c
spent
true